How much does a mobile equipment mechanic make?

The average mobile equipment mechanic salary in the United States is $72,190. Mobile equipment mechanic salaries typically range between $45,000 and $115,000 yearly. The average hourly rate for mobile equipment mechanics is $34.71 per hour.

Mobile equipment mechanic salary is impacted by location, education, and experience. Mobile equipment mechanics earn the highest average salary in Massachusetts.

Mobile Equipment Mechanic salary trends

The average mobile equipment mechanic salary has risen by $12,716 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average mobile equipment mechanic earned $59,474 annually, but today, they earn $72,190 a year. That works out to a 12% change in pay for mobile equipment mechanics over the last decade.
